Liverpool creative agency OneMay has teamed up with the Liverpool City Region Combined Authority and the Digital Inclusion Network to launch Helping You Online — a campaign tackling digital poverty across the region. With seven million adults and one in five children in the UK living with digital poverty, the challenge is especially acute in Liverpool City Region, where more than 245,000 people lack essential digital skills and 127,000 still remain offline. At the heart of the campaign is a free 80+ page booklet, designed to help residents build digital confidence, improve online safety, access healthcare, save money and connect with local support. Co-designed with members of the Digital Inclusion Network, it brings together trusted resources in one accessible guide – available both digitally and in print.
